    How to design busbar grounding for power distribution cabinets

    The busbar or vertical grounding strip should be used to provide a visually verifiable, all-copper grounding path. When equipment does not provide a lug-mounting pad, the next best option is to bond the equipment mounting flanges directly to the rack rails.     Construction Guidelines for Cable Trays in Computer Rooms

    The International Electrotechnical Commission (IEC) provides detailed guidelines for cable tray systems under IEC 61537. This standard outlines the construction requirements, testing methods, and performance parameters for cable trays and related support systems. These systems provide an efficient and adaptable solution for managing a wide range of cables, including power cables, control cables, Ethernet, and fiber optic lines.     Calculation of Quota for Telecommunication Towers

    Tower Height: The exact vertical height required. . A telecommunication tower quotation represents a comprehensive pricing document that outlines the costs, specifications, and implementation details for cellular communication infrastructure projects. This essential document serves as the foundation for network expansion initiatives, providing. Telecom tower pricing typically ranges from $15,000 to over $150,000 for the structure itself, heavily dependent on height, design type, and current global steel prices. A standard 40-meter lattice tower might cost significantly less than a camouflaged monopole of the same height due to design.
